Red Hat Security Advisory: Red Hat JBoss Web Server 5.8.5 release and security update
🔗 CVE IDs covered (6)
📋 Description
CVE-2025-48976 — apache-commons-fileupload: Apache Commons FileUpload DoS via part headers CVE-2025-48988 — tomcat: Apache Tomcat DoS in multipart upload CVE-2025-49125 — tomcat: Apache Tomcat: Security constraint bypass for pre/post-resources CVE-2025-52434 — tomcat: Apache Tomcat denial of service CVE-2025-52520 — tomcat: Apache Tomcat denial of service CVE-2025-53506 — tomcat: Apache Tomcat denial of service
